Finance Review Summary — Training Budget FY Next

For the board: the proposed training budget for Halverton Systems rises 12% over the current year, driven mainly by certification programs in the Denmoor engineering group. Per-head spend remains below sector benchmarks. Finance recommends approving the base allocation now and deferring the leadership-academy line until mid-year review. Savings from the retired Quillfall platform partially offset the increase. Board members should review the confidential item that follows before Thursday's vote.

confidential, kagup-bafog: Fraaxax Group is in early talks to buy Soroxox Group for about $343.8 million. The Olidor launch date is June 14, and nothing goes to the press before then. Legal wants the Aldmirek Logistics term sheet signed before July 23.

When reviewing changes to Lanternmill's configuration system, keep in mind that most services hot-reload their config: the watcher process detects file changes, validates the new values against the schema, and swaps them in atomically without a restart. Reviewers should confirm that any new config key has a validation rule and a sane fallback, because a rejected reload silently keeps the old values, which has caused confusion before. The full hot-reload semantics, including ordering guarantees and rollback behavior, are described here:

wiki page, tahaf-tajog: https://jira.ordindyn.corp/pipeline

## Changelog — Ledgerpane 4.2

Changed defaults: the audit-log viewer now retains filter state across sessions and caps exports at 50,000 rows by default. Support should expect questions from customers who relied on unlimited exports; point them to the admin override. After upgrade, instances that have not been customized will run with the following settings.

config for kafof-bawef:
holath:
  log_level: debug
  metrics_host: metrics.holath.qorvelsys.internal
  pin: 2191
  pool_size: 32